Ионная собственная вибрация на IOS

У меня небольшая проблема с плагином встроенной вибрации ionic. https://ionicframework.com/docs/native/vibration/

Как вы, возможно, знаете, вы больше не можете устанавливать время или шаблон вибрации для пользователей iOS. Однако в своем приложении я собираюсь создать будильник, чтобы он воспроизводил звук или вибрировал, пока пользователь не встряхнет устройство. Вы знаете какой-либо способ обхода этой проблемы, чтобы она работала и на IOS? Или хотя бы 30 секундную вибрацию?


person user3551399    schedule 19.01.2018    source источник


Ответы (1)


возможно, вы можете использовать setInterval вот так

let stop = false;
let timer = setInterval(()=>{
    if(stop){clearInterval(timer)}
    this.vibration.vibrate(1000);
},1000)

а при остановке === true не будет вибрировать

person coder    schedule 11.08.2018